titleOfInvention Method of cleaning arsenic-polluted solvents
abstract FIELD: waste water treatment. n SUBSTANCE: invention relates to treatment of waste waters and solvents containing significant amounts of hydrochloric or sulfuric acid and arsenic and can be used in metallurgy, especially in manufacture of nonferrous metals, as well as in chemical industry. Method consists in that arsenic is precipitated by sulfide-containing reagent, e.g. sodium hydrosulfide, said sulfide-containing reagent being added to solution to be treated from below while simultaneously stirring the solution. Specific weight consumption of the reagent is not higher than 1.5 kg*S -2 *h -1 . Hydrodynamic regime of stirring is maintained within the Reynolds number range 600 to 6000. Precipitation of arsenic is effected until its residual concentration in solution not below 0.03 g/dm 3 . Addition of sulfide-containing reagent is stopped when redox potential value is achieved in the curve break point on diagram depicting consumption of the reagent as function of arsenic concentration in solution. n EFFECT: achieved simplicity and safety of arsenic precipitation excluding emission of toxic gases. n 1 dwg, 3 tbl
